Tips for Moving in Margaret River

  1. Book ahead during peak periods. Vintage (harvest season, roughly February–April) and summer holidays are the busiest times of year in the region — both for us and for finding tradespeople, cleaners and accommodation generally. Booking 2–4 weeks out gives you the best shot at your preferred date.

  2. Flag rural or acreage access early. Long driveways, gates, or unsealed roads change what kind of truck and how much time we allocate — better to know upfront than to discover it on the day.

  3. Plan around town events. Margaret River hosts a lot of festivals and events through the year that affect traffic and parking in town — worth checking the calendar against your moving date if you're relocating within town.

  4. Ask about storage if you need it. Settlement dates rarely line up perfectly — we can help bridge the gap.
